1. The Florida Keys
Running from Key Largo to Key West, the Florida Keys comprise a series of enchanting islands connected by the Overseas Highway. Navigating through this route offers stunning views of turquoise waters, coral reefs, and vibrant sunsets. Don't miss the chance to anchor at celebrated destinations like the Dry Tortugas National Park and John Pennekamp Coral Reef State Park, where magnificent snorkeling and diving opportunities await.
2. The Pacific Northwest: San Juan Islands
The San Juan Islands, located in the Pacific Northwest between Washington State and Canada, are a treasure trove of stunning landscapes and wildlife. Sail through serene waters dotted with beautiful islands, each boasting unique charm and character. Keep an eye out for orcas, seals, and sea lions as you navigate this idyllic route. Lime Kiln Point State Park on San Juan Island is a fantastic spot to view whales during the migration season.
3. The Intracoastal Waterway
This extensive waterway stretches from Boston, Massachusetts, down to the southern tip of Florida. A journey along the Intracoastal Waterway allows you to experience a variety of environments and charming coastal towns. From the historical sites in Charleston, South Carolina, to the vibrant nightlife in Miami, this route showcases the diverse coastal culture and rich heritage of the Eastern Seaboard.
4. The Maine Coast
Maine’s coastline is dotted with rugged cliffs, picturesque lighthouses, and quaint seaside villages. Sailing around the islands of the Penobscot Bay, including Isle au Haut and Mount Desert Island, offers breathtaking views and opportunities for exploration. Acadia National Park, located on Mount Desert Island, features stunning trails, dramatic vistas, and rich wildlife, making it an essential stop on your voyage.
5. The Great Lakes
The Great Lakes offer a unique yacht route away from the ocean, with options for both freshwater sailing and exploration of charming harbor towns. From Lake Michigan to Lake Superior, discover the beauty of America’s largest group of freshwater lakes. Notable stops include Door County in Wisconsin and the picturesque islands of Mackinac Island in Michigan, known for its vibrant history and stunning landscapes. The diverse ecosystems and breathtaking views are sure to impress anyone sailing through this region.
6. The Hawaiian Islands
Sailing in Hawaii is like a dream come true, with each island offering its own unique beauty. Explore the lush landscapes of Kauai, the volcanic terrain of the Big Island, and the pristine beaches of Maui. The calm waters and favorable winds make it an ideal destination for both novice sailors and experienced yachtsmen. Make sure to anchor at Molokai or Lanai for a truly serene experience away from the hustle and bustle of tourist hotspots.
7. The Chesapeake Bay
As one of the largest estuaries in the United States, the Chesapeake Bay is famous for its rich maritime heritage and stunning natural beauty. Sail past charming towns like Annapolis, renowned for its sailing culture, and St. Michaels, known for its historic charm. The bay is also home to an array of wildlife and offers excellent opportunities for fishing and crabbing, making it a perfect spot for a leisurely yacht trip.
